Subject: [PATCH 18/29] rtc: spear: switch to devm_rtc_allocate_device
Date: Wed, 9 Mar 2022 17:22:49 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220309162301.61679-18-alexandre.belloni@bootlin.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220309162301.61679-1-alexandre.belloni@bootlin.com>
Switch to devm_rtc_allocate_device/devm_rtc_register_device, this allows
for further improvement of the driver.
Signed-off-by: Alexandre Belloni <alexandre.belloni@bootlin.com>
---
drivers/rtc/rtc-spear.c | 18 +++++++++---------
1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/rtc/rtc-spear.c b/drivers/rtc/rtc-spear.c
index b4a520056b1a..1b40380aaba2 100644
--- a/drivers/rtc/rtc-spear.c
+++ b/drivers/rtc/rtc-spear.c
@@ -352,6 +352,10 @@ static int spear_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
if (!config)
return -ENOMEM;
+ config->rtc = devm_rtc_allocate_device(&pdev->dev);
+ if (IS_ERR(config->rtc))
+ return PTR_ERR(config->rtc);
+
/* alarm irqs */
irq = platform_get_irq(pdev, 0);
if (irq < 0)
@@ -380,17 +384,13 @@ static int spear_rtc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
spin_lock_init(&config->lock);
platform_set_drvdata(pdev, config);
- config->rtc = devm_rtc_device_register(&pdev->dev, pdev->name,
- &spear_rtc_ops, THIS_MODULE);
- if (IS_ERR(config->rtc)) {
- dev_err(&pdev->dev, "can't register RTC device, err %ld\n",
- PTR_ERR(config->rtc));
- status = PTR_ERR(config->rtc);
- goto err_disable_clock;
- }
-
+ config->rtc->ops = &spear_rtc_ops;
config->rtc->uie_unsupported = 1;
+ status = devm_rtc_register_device(config->rtc);
+ if (status)
+ goto err_disable_clock;
+
if (!device_can_wakeup(&pdev->dev))
device_init_wakeup(&pdev->dev, 1);
